ati fan modification question

been a long time, but i helped a friend install an ati supercharger on his lt1 camaro. i remember some spacers that it came with to move the fan closer to the radiator for a little extra room.

anyone have the directions, or a picture of what is done? im trying to get a little extra clearence for my turbo setup and was thinking of copying that. do you pull the fan our and put it in the other side of the fan shroud?

from what i remember you take the shroud out, then pull the motors off. put spacers or washers in for the bolts that secure the motor to the shroud so that it sits in deeper. hope that makes sense
